1.2.2 Working Mode
R6FG has two working modes:normal working mode and gyro function working mode.
Normal Working Mode
Green LED, gyro will not working.
Gyro Function Working Mode
Both green and red LED on.
The gyro function of receiver R6FG for professional car drifting can be enabled and disabled. When it’s
enabled, the turning stability can be maximized during competition. When there is false position, gyro function
keeps the car straight forward and turn precisely.
1.2.3 How to Turn On Gyro Function
Short press ID SET three times with interval less than 1s, the RED indicator flashes three times. Red LED
on/off indicates the gyro function is on/off.

Gyro Setup
A. Gyro Enabled
Short press ID SET three times with interval less than 1s, the RED indicator flashes three times. Red LED
on/off indicates the gyro function is on/off.
B. Gyro Phase
When the gyro forward is enabled, try to turn the model car to see if the gyro is correcting the wheels.
Normally, the wheels should turn right to correct when the car is turned left while the wheels should turn left to
correct when the car is turned right. If the gyro phase is reversed, short press ID SET twice with interval less
than 1s. The Red indicator flashes twice means the gyro phase setting is complete.
